Uberall logo

Frontend Engineer

Uberall

Job Summary

Uberall is seeking a Mid-Level Frontend Engineer with expertise in React to join their team. As part of the company's mission to empower businesses to thrive locally, the engineer will work on building and enhancing next-generation web applications. The role involves collaborating with product managers, UX/UI designers, and backend engineers to deliver impactful features on a global scale. Uberall offers a flexible remote work option, competitive pay and perks, and opportunities for growth and development. The company values diversity, inclusion, and belonging, and strives to create a culture of continuous learning and improvement.

The Past, Present & Future

The Past: Uberall was founded in 2013 by David Federhen and Florian Hübner, two longtime friends with a vision to improve customer experience across the online and offline worlds. They created a platform that connected companies with local customers in the digital-first moment. 

The Present: We're on a mission to empower businesses to thrive locally, and believe every business deserves success, regardless of size or location. Simply put, our location marketing platform exists to help our customers get found online and connect with customers through search, discovery, engagement, and conversion. 

The Future: We're a growing company with a bright future, and our journey to become the global leader in location marketing is well underway. We are looking for a Mid-Level Frontend Engineer with expertise in React to help us build and enhance our next-generation web applications. As part of our collaborative team, you’ll create seamless, responsive, and visually compelling user interfaces that drive exceptional customer experiences. You’ll work closely with our product, design, and backend teams to deliver impactful features on a global scale.

Key Responsibilities:

    • Develop and maintain responsive, high-performance web applications using React.
    • Collaborate with product managers and UX/UI designers to transform concepts into intuitive, user-friendly interfaces.
    • Write clean, maintainable, and scalable code, adhering to best practices in frontend development.
    • Optimize applications for maximum speed and performance across various devices and platforms.
    • Troubleshoot, debug and resolve frontend issues to ensure a smooth user experience.
    • Work with backend engineers to integrate frontend components with our microservices architecture.
    • Actively participate in code reviews, offering and receiving feedback to improve code quality.
    • Stay current with the latest trends and advancements in frontend technologies and contribute to continuous improvement.

Requirements:

    • 2-4 years of experience as a frontend engineer with strong proficiency in React.
    • Solid understanding of JavaScript/TypeScript, HTML5, and CSS3.
    • Strong understanding of responsive web design and cross-browser compatibility.
    • Experience working with RESTful APIs and integrating frontend with backend services.
    • Familiarity with modern frontend build tools (e.g., Webpack, Babel) and version control (Git).
    • Experience working in Agile environments, preferably in a Scrum team.

Nice to Have:

    • Experience with testing frameworks (e.g., Jest, React Testing Library).
    • Understanding of accessibility standards and best practices (WCAG).
    • Experience with frontend performance optimization techniques.
    •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ines and DevOps tools.
